I'll start with a few:
A painter paints the appearance of things, not their objective correctness, in fact he creates new appearances of things.
–Ernst Ludwig Kirchner
I've never believed in God, but I believe in Picasso.
-Diego Rivera
I dream a lot. I do more painting when I'm not painting. It's in the subconscious.
- Andrew Wyeth
I’m not an abstractionist. I’m not interested in the relationship of color or form or anything else. I’m interested only in expressing basic human emotions: tragedy, ecstasy, doom, and so on.
-Mark Rothko
I certainly hope to sell in the course of time, but I think I shall be able to influence it most effectively by working steadily on, and that at the present moment making desperate efforts to force the work I am doing now upon the public would be pretty useless.
-Vincent van Gogh

REFLECTIONS ON ART
"It is useful for an artist to know all forms of art which have preceded him. But must be very careful not to look for models. As soon as one artist takes on another as a model,he is lost.
Why should I try to imitate nature? I might just as well trace a perfect circle. What I have to do is utilise as best I can the ideas which objects suggest to me, connect, fust and colour in my way the shadows they cast within me,illuminate them from inside.
And since from necessity my vision is quite different from that of the next man, my painting will interpret things in an entirely manner."
PICASSO(c1948)
